Silves is both a region and a city in the Algarve. The municipality has a total area of 679 km2 and approximately 35,000 inhabitants. The Silves Region is centrally located in the Algarve between the provinces of Lagao and Albufeira. The region runs a long way inland from the coast. The main cities are Armação de Pêra and Silves.

The rich history of Silves

Silves is the oldest town in the Algarve. The fortress towers high above the city. The city flourished under Moorish rule. In 966 the city was sacked by Harald I of Denmark. In the 11th and 12th centuries the city was the independent taifa of Silves. The city was an important economic and cultural center and had more than 30,000 inhabitants. Today the fortress is an important tourist attraction, as well as navigating the old trade route across the Rio Arade to Portimão.

A different story is for Armação de Pêra, this originally fishing village owes its expansion mainly to the increasing tourism in the Algarve.

Castelo dos Mouros
Silves Castle. Actually, you cannot ignore this, as soon as you enter Silves you will see the enormous castle appear. It is an iconic red sandstone structure built by the Moors at the highest point in the city. For the Moors it was the most important defense work for this important city. The literal translation of Castelo dos Mouros is Castle of the Moors.

In Silves, just like in Vila Real de Santo António, the Feira Medieval is celebrated. Concerts are then organized around the castle and during the day there are all kinds of stalls around the castle. This medieval festival is also popular among the locals. If you are in the Algarve in August, this is a must.

Sé Cathedral is also worth a visit in Silves. Good to combine with a walk through this beautiful old town.

Trade route on the Rio Arade this historically important route can be viewed on foot or by boat. It is wonderful to walk along the banks of the Rio Arade and enjoy all the beauty you encounter. Another option is the boat trip. The advantage of the boat trip is that a guide can tell you the history of this route.
